High Efficiency Photoflash Capacitor Charger in 2mm x 3mm DFN



MILPITAS, CA - September 19, 2005 - Linear Technology Corporation announces the LT3484 family of high efficiency, ultra-fast, photoflash capacitor (typically 320V) chargers. These ICs designed as stand-alone devices, eliminating microprocessor loading and the extensive software development normally associated with other photoflash charger solutions.

This family of photoflash capacitor charger ICs is designed for use in digital camera and mobile phone applications where space is at a premium. The LT3484's patented control technique allows it to use extremely small transformers and the onboard NPN power switch requires no external Schottky diode clamp, reducing solution size. Output voltage detection needs no external circuitry as the transformer turns ratio determines final charge voltage.

These devices have an input voltage range of 1.8V to 16V, making them ideal for applications powered by 2 AA alkaline cells or single cell Li-Ion batteries. The LT3484-0, -2 and -1 have primary current limits of 1.4A, 1A and 0.7A respectively, resulting in tightly controlled average input current of 500mA, 350mA and 225mA, respectively. The three versions are otherwise identical.

The CHARGE pin gives full control of the part to the user. Driving CHARGE low puts the part in shutdown. The DONE pin indicates when the part has completed charging. The LT3484 series of is offered in a tiny low profile 2mm x 3mm DFN package.

Summary of Features: LT3484-0, -1, -2
Highly Integrated IC in 2mm x 3mm DFN Package
Reduces Solution Size
Uses Small Transformers: 5.8mm x 5.8mm x 3mm
Fast Photoflash Charge Times:
- 4.6s for LT3484-0 (0V to 320V, 100uF, VIN = 3.6V)
- 5.7s for LT3484-2 (0V to 320V, 100uF, VIN = 3.6V)
- 5.5s for LT3484-1 (0V to 320V, 50uF, VIN = 3.6V)
Operates from Two AA Batteries, or Any Supply from 1.8V up to 16V
Controlled Average Input Current:
- 500mA (LT3484-0)
- 350mA (LT3484-2)
- 225mA (LT3484-1)

Company Background
Linear Technology Corporation, a manufacturer of high performance linear integrated circuits, was founded in 1981, became a public company in 1986 and joined the S&P index of major public companies in 2000. Linear Technology products include high performance amplifiers, comparators, voltage references, monolithic filters, linear regulators, DC-DC converters, battery chargers, data converters, communications interface circuits, RF signal conditioning circuits, and many other analog functions. Applications for Linear Technology's high performance circuits include telecommunications, cellular telephones, networking products such as optical switches, notebook and desktop computers, computer peripherals, video/multimedia, industrial instrumentation, security monitoring devices, high-end consumer products such as digital cameras and MP3 players, complex medical devices, automotive electronics, factory automation, process control, and military and space systems.
